#ebf537 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ebf537 is composed of 92.2% red, 96.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 63.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#ebf537 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#d7e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#ebf537 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ebf537 has RGB values of R:235, G:245,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15463735.

Hex triplet ebf537 #ebf537
RGB Decimal 235, 245, 55 rgb(235,245,55)
RGB Percent 92.2, 96.1, 21.6 rgb(92.2%,96.1%,21.6%)
CMYK 4, 0, 78, 4
HSL 63.2°, 90.5, 58.8 hsl(63.2,90.5%,58.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 63.2°, 77.6, 96.1
Web Safe ffff33 #ffff33
CIE-LAB 93.121, -24.03, 82.335
XYZ 67.603, 83.244, 16.121
xyY 0.405, 0.499, 83.244
CIE-LCH 93.121, 85.77, 106.27
CIE-LUV 93.121, 0.386, 97.664
Hunter-Lab 91.238, -27.406, 53.391
Binary 11101011, 11110101, 00110111

Shades and Tints of #ebf537

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ebf537

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9c90 is the less saturated color, while #f2fd2f is the most saturated one.
